Midland College Achieves Record Enrollment, Surpasses Previous All-Time High Set in 2010

During the October 14, 2025, meeting of the Midland College Board of Trustees, Vice President of Strategy and Analytics Tom Glenn reported that MC has reached the highest fall enrollment in its 50-year history. A total of 7,336 students are enrolled for Fall 2025, surpassing the previous record of 7,195 set in 2010.

Diamondback Energy and Midland College Partner to Launch Diamondback DNA I&E Mentorship Program

Diamondback Energy and Midland College are launching the Diamondback DNA Instrumentation & Electrical (I&E) Mentorship Program. This program aims to increase the number of credentialed I&E technicians in the Permian Basin. Technicians fulfill a critical oil and gas industry role to ensure safe and efficient operation of complex equipment and control systems.

Midland College to Host FAFSA and TASFA Info Sessions at Cogdell Learning Center

Midland College will host two information sessions to help students and families navigate the 2026-2027 FAFSA and TASFA financial aid process for the next academic year. The sessions will take place on Thursday, October 23, and Wednesday, November 12, from 9-11 a.m. at the Cogdell Learning Center Annex Building, 201 W. Florida Ave.

Filing the FAFSA®: Your First Step Toward College Support

Every year, I get the same question from students: "Do I really need to fill out the FAFSA®?" And my answer is always the same: "Absolutely, yes!" On Oct. 1, 2025, the 2026-2027 FAFSA® (Free Application for Federal Student Aid) will officially open. This single application is the gateway to nearly every type of financial aid available, from scholarships and grants, to work-study funds and student loans.
